ASTANA. KAZINFORM - Belinda Bencic has been crowned as the WTA's Newcomer of the Year, Kazinform has learnt from the WTA's official website.

The 17-year-old Swiss was one of the brightest young stars in the world of tennis this year. Bencic who secured 46% of fan votes said: "It's a great honor and privilege to have been voted the WTA's Newcomer of the Year 2014". She also added that the year was challenging and rewarding. Edged by Bencic, Zarina Diyas of Kazakhstan came second with 23% of fan votes. But Zarina beat other rising tennis stars such as Kurumi Nara of Japan and Shelby Rogers of the U.S. In addition, the 21-year-old Kazakhstani is at №33 of the updated WTA ranking.
